AI Technical Summary
Conventional cut-off saws lack effective cooling mechanisms for components such as battery packs, printed circuit boards, and electric motors, especially when cutting heavy materials, leading to potential overheating and reduced performance.
A cut-off saw design featuring a clamshell housing with partitioned compartments and air intake and outlet openings that facilitate cooling air flow paths around the battery pack and motor, including a direct-drive blade system and an air curtain to manage debris and improve visibility.
Enhances cooling efficiency for battery packs, motors, and control electronics, while also providing an air curtain to manage debris and improve user safety and visibility during operation.
